The data indicates that an overwhelming majority of BMW XM (2022-) vehicles have their most recent recorded mileage within the 0 to 10,000 miles range, accounting for approximately 98.8%. There are very few records—each representing just 0.3%—for vehicles with mileage readings between 20,000 and 30,000 miles, 40,000 and 50,000 miles, 70,000 and 80,000 miles, and 120,000 and 130,000 miles. This suggests that most BMW XM owners tend to keep their vehicles relatively low in mileage, possibly indicating that these vehicles are often purchased new and kept for a few years before resale or reporting.

The data presents private sale price distribution percentages for the BMW XM (2022-) in the UK, across various price ranges. Notably, most price brackets show very low percentages, generally below 5%, indicating relatively few vehicles are sold within each specific range. The highest concentration appears around the £84,000 to £86,000 mark, with a significant 13.1%, suggesting this is a common or typical sale price point for these models. Furthermore, extremely high or low price brackets—such as over £132,000 or below £53,000—have minimal activity, implying they are less typical sale prices. Overall, the data suggests that the majority of private sales cluster around the mid-£80,000s with some spread, highlighting the commonly observed market value range for the BMW XM (2022-).

The data indicates that the most common main paint colour for BMW XM (2022-) vehicles is black, accounting for 59% of the sample. Other notable colours include grey (14.4%) and blue (12.2%), making up a significant portion of the fleet. Less prevalent colours are green (9.5%), white (1.8%), red (1.8%), yellow (0.9%), purple (0.3%), and a small percentage of other colours. This suggests that black remains the dominant choice for this model, with a modest variety of other colours, especially green and blue.

The data indicates that the majority of BMW XM (2022-) vehicles have only one registered keeper, accounting for approximately 80.7%. Additionally, a small proportion, about 6.4%, have had two keepers, while 11.3% have an unspecified number of keepers. Very few vehicles, around 1.5%, have had three keepers. Overall, this suggests that most owners tend to retain the vehicle for an extended period, reflecting a relatively stable ownership pattern for this model.

The data indicates that nearly all BMW XM (2022-) vehicles are equipped with either a 2998cc or a 4395cc engine, with the smaller 2998cc engine being more common at 59%. Additionally, an overwhelming majority of these vehicles, 99.7%, are primarily fueled by hybrid electric powertrains, highlighting a strong trend towards hybrid technology in this model. Only a negligible 0.3% utilize a petrol-electric combination, underscoring the vehicle's predominant focus on hybrid propulsion.
